Regulatory Scrutiny
The collapse of Silvergate highlights a significant issue in the crypto world: regulatory scrutiny. Cryptocurrencies have often been at odds with traditional banking regulations, which are increasingly becoming stricter. The scrutiny around crypto transactions has intensified, leading to greater compliance challenges for banks that engage with the crypto space. The need for robust KYC (Know Your Customer) and AML (Anti-Money Laundering) processes has become more stringent, making it harder for banks to navigate this regulatory landscape.

Global Regulatory Framework
The global regulatory framework for cryptocurrencies is still evolving, with different countries adopting varying approaches. In the United States, the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) and the Financial Crimes Enforcement Network (FinCEN) are playing pivotal roles in shaping the regulatory landscape. The European Union has also introduced comprehensive regulations, such as the Markets in Crypto-Assets Regulation (MiCA), to ensure consumer protection and market integrity.

Smart Contracts and Automation
Smart contracts, which automate the execution of agreements when certain conditions are met, are revolutionizing the way transactions are conducted. These contracts eliminate the need for intermediaries, reducing costs and increasing efficiency. They also enhance security by ensuring that transactions are executed exactly as programmed.
Cross-Chain Solutions
Cross-chain solutions enable interoperability between different blockchain networks, facilitating seamless transactions across various platforms. This advancement is crucial for the future of crypto banking, as it allows for the integration of diverse blockchain ecosystems and promotes broader adoption of cryptocurrencies.

The Rise of Stablecoins
Stablecoins, cryptocurrencies pegged to stable assets like the US dollar, have gained significant traction in the wake of Silvergate's collapse. These digital currencies aim to mitigate the volatility associated with traditional cryptocurrencies, making them more accessible for everyday transactions. Stablecoins are increasingly being used for cross-border payments, remittances, and as a store of value.
